Sodium peroxide which is a yellow solid, when exposed to air becomes white due to the formation of

Solution

Correct option is

NaOH and Na2CO3 

 

In presence of moisture and CO2 present in air, Na2O2 is converted to NaOH and Na2CO3 respectively both of which are white
